RC6432F4873CS Equivalent & Substitute Parts Reference
Part Overview
The RC6432F4873CS is a 487 kOhms ±1% 1W chip resistor manufactured by Samsung Electro-Mechanics in the 2512 (6432 Metric) package. This thick film, moisture-resistant component operates across -55°C to 155°C and is ROHS3 compliant. The part is currently in active production status with 1117 units available in stock.

Substitute Part Grouping Explanation
Substitution eligibility is determined by strict alignment of the following parameters:
Electrical Parameters (Must Match):
- Resistance value: 487 kOhms
- Tolerance: ±1%
- Power rating: 1W
- Temperature coefficient: ±100ppm/°C
- Operating temperature range: -55°C ~ 155°C
Mechanical Parameters (Must Match):
- Package designation: 2512 (6432 Metric)
- Number of terminations: 2
- Composition: Thick Film
Compliance Parameters (Must Match or Exceed):
- RoHS3 compliance
- Moisture Sensitivity Level: 1 (Unlimited)
The identified substitute ERJ-1TNF4873U from Panasonic Electronic Components meets all electrical and mechanical requirements. Dimensional variations within manufacturing tolerances (length 6.40mm vs. 6.30mm, height 0.70mm vs. 0.66mm) remain within acceptable PCB layout margins for 2512 package applications.

Engineering Selection Recommendations
RC6432F4873CS (Samsung Electro-Mechanics):
- Active product status supports long-term availability
- Moisture-resistant feature designation
- 1117 units in current inventory
- Suitable for standard industrial and commercial applications
ERJ-1TNF4873U (Panasonic Electronic Components):
- Product status: Not For New Designs
- AEC-Q200 automotive qualification provides enhanced reliability documentation
- 2048 units in current inventory
- Suitable for applications requiring automotive-grade component traceability
- Tape & Reel packaging standard for automated assembly
Selection between these parts depends on application requirements. The Samsung part supports new design implementations. The Panasonic part provides automotive-grade qualification but is designated not for new designs, limiting its use to legacy system maintenance or applications with specific AEC-Q200 requirements.
Frequently Asked Questions (FAQ)
Q: Can ERJ-1TNF4873U replace RC6432F4873CS in new designs?
A: ERJ-1TNF4873U meets all electrical and mechanical specifications for functional equivalence. However, Panasonic designates this part "Not For New Designs," which may conflict with design lifecycle policies. RC6432F4873CS maintains active status and is the preferred choice for new implementations.
Q: Are the dimensional differences between these parts significant?
A: Length differs by 0.10mm (6.40mm vs. 6.30mm) and height by 0.04mm (0.70mm vs. 0.66mm). These variations fall within standard PCB layout tolerances for 2512 package footprints and do not require design modification.
Q: What is the significance of AEC-Q200 qualification on the Panasonic part?
A: AEC-Q200 is an automotive industry standard for passive component reliability. This qualification provides documented stress testing and failure rate data. It is relevant only for applications requiring automotive-grade component traceability.
Q: Do both parts require identical moisture handling procedures?
A: Both parts carry MSL Rating 1 (Unlimited), indicating no moisture sensitivity restrictions. Standard handling procedures for surface mount components apply equally to both parts.
Q: What packaging formats are available?
A: RC6432F4873CS is supplied in standard packaging format. ERJ-1TNF4873U is supplied in Tape & Reel (TR) format, standard for automated assembly processes.
Q: Are there compliance differences between these parts?
A: Both parts are ROHS3 compliant and REACH unaffected. No regulatory compliance differentiation exists between the two parts.
